v0.8.43 — an axis declaration is not a topic name
Fixed
-
An axis declaration can no longer enter the graph as a topic. A project
says which project a record belongs to. It is established at first write
from the client's working directory, and it is carried by its own edge — it is
never a subject a record can be about. A previous release closed the typed
door: the enrichment daemon can no longer create a project node, nor point any
relation at one. This closes the untyped door beside it, which is the one the
data actually came through.A name of the form
Project: <something>is an ordinary entity name. It never
touches the label allowlist, so nothing in the typed gate could see it, and it
arrived on the same relation every genuine topic uses. Measured on a live
corpus before the repair: eleven such entities carrying 152 inbound edges,
the largest of them the graph's second-biggest hub with 91. Every record that
merely named a project was being clustered with every other record naming
it — which is a cluster keyed on the axis, not on a theme, and it had reached
the point of anchoring narrative folds.The inbound entity-name gate now rejects the
Project:/Domain:form
wherever names enter the graph.This is deliberately a test of the name's FORM, never a lookup against the
project registry — the obvious implementation, and the wrong one. Registered
project names are frequently real topics in their own right: a project is
often named after the very thing its records discuss, and short registry names
are ordinary English words. Measured on this corpus, one registry row was
simultaneously a system entity carrying 91 inbound edges — a gate that
resolved bare names against the registry would have deleted a hub of true
statements the same size as the axis hub it was meant to remove. A name that
spells outProject:has declared which axis it is on; a bare name has
declared nothing. Keeping it a form test also keeps the check pure — no
database, no I/O.Domain:is rejected before the domain axis exists, on purpose: the axis is
specified, and the same mistake is otherwise made twice.⚠ The gate governs what reaches the graph, never what is stored. A
rejected name stays verbatim in the record's own metadata and remains
searchable there — the episodic tier is left pristine, as it is for every
other name this gate rejects.
